That translates on the drink menu to items like the Pisco cocktail, using the national spirit of Peru, a grappalike liqueur which Merino mixes with aga vero, a tequila made from damiana flowers, quince syrup, lime juice, and a half-ounce of aloe vera. Another signature drink, Merino says, will be his Mescal cocktail, consisting of Scorpion Mescal, Cointreau, fresh smashed ginger, and lime, jícama, and pineapple juices. “These cocktails are estilo libre, freestyle,” Merino says. “We’re just letting these unique flavors come together.” For a young guy, Merino has a lot of fans in cocktail circles, and from what we hear, a lot of them are looking forward to finding out what he has mixed up at Rayuela.
